Description

A handsome three bedroom, two bathroom period home situated close to the heart of the ever popular village of Milborne Port, pleasant leafy setting and established gardens.


Thought to have been built in 1901, this lovely period home is built of stone elevations and attractive brick quoining under slate and tiled roofs, occupying a secluded position on Wheathill Lane away from passing traffic. As you would expect from a property of this age, there are some charming character features including stripped floorboards, deep sills and fireplaces which really complement the modern updates undertaken by the current owners and combine modern day living with a real sense of character.
The property has desirable open plan living space with a lovely kitchen/dining room as well as separate living areas which offer much flexibility on the ground floor. The kitchen is fitted with a range of attractive shaker style cupboards, an electric hob and oven and has space for an American fridge/freezer and dishwasher, other white goods can be accommodated in the separate utility area which has a Belfast sink, further storage and under floor heating. Besides the kitchen there is an office which provides a great work from home space or playroom and conveniently next door there is a contemporary shower room which has a large shower cubicle with rainfall shower system, wc, basin and heated towel rail.
The sitting room is a charming cosy space featuring stripped floorboards and fireplace with wood burning stove and oak mantel.
Upstairs there are two double bedrooms and a generous third bedroom which are served by a family bathroom.

4 Wheathill Lane is situated close to the heart of the popular village of Milborne Port which is conveniently placed just three miles to the East of the historic Abbey town of Sherborne. The village has an unusual amount of local amenities which include a butchers, an award winning fish and chip shop with restaurant, a chemist, a Coop food store, a doctor’s surgery, two public houses, a social club, a fine and well-regarded restaurant "The Clockspire", a primary school, two churches and a village hall. There is also a regular bus service to Sherborne, Yeovil and Wincanton which provide between them an excellent range of cultural, recreational and shopping facilities. Sporting, walking and riding opportunities abound within the area with golf clubs at both Sherborne and Yeovil while the region is well known for both its public and privately funded schooling. Communication links are good with a main line station at Sherborne linking directly with London Waterloo while road links are along the A303 joined at Wincanton giving swift access to London and the Home Counties along the M3, M25 route.

A pedestrian pathway leads to a gate to the property and into the gardens which are set in leafy surroundings and have a real sense of seclusion. There are large established beds planted with seasonal shrubs, punctuated with paved stepping stones and specimen trees, an area of lawn with further paving, fish pond, enclosed vegetable beds, garden shed and garden store.
Parking is available on Wheathill Lane, the current owners use the layby immediately to the side of the pedestrian pathway to the property.
